'tuyo' is the equivalent of 'yours/thine' in English, and relating to a masculine noun.
'Este es tu libro' = 'This is your book'
'Este libro es tuyo' = 'This book is yours'

To make tuyo (dried fish) stay longer, store it in an airtight container in a cool, dry place. Additionally, you can freeze it to extend its shelf life significantly. Ensure that the tuyo is completely dry before storing, as moisture can lead to spoilage. For added preservation, consider using vacuum sealing.
